“If we as a world ever got even a hint of the incredible love with which God loves us, we would be living in such a different world than we do now.” These are the wise words of Mpho Andrea Tutu van Furth, Tami Simon’s guest in this deeply moving podcast. Give a listen to this inspiring conversation with the daughter of the late Archbishop Desmond Tutu and coauthor of the online course Unstoppable Joy

Tami and Mpho explore deep faith and finding one’s path to God; the human tendency to act in ways that are counter to love; shifting from unworthiness to unconditional love; having a faith journey and “forging your own way up the mountain”; carrying forth the legacy of Desmond Tutu for a more just and inclusive world; the transformative teaching, “When in doubt, choose love”; real courage; accessing the source of unstoppable joy; disagreeing without being disagreeable; the practice of “disappearing into prayer”; and more.

The Reverend Canon Mpho Tutu van Furth is an Episcopal priest, artist, author, accomplished public speaker, and retreat facilitator. She was the founding executive director of the Desmond and Leah Tutu Legacy Foundation. With her wife, Marceline, she has established the Tutu Teach Foundation to enhance access to opportunity for women. Ms. Tutu van Furth and her wife live in the Netherlands. They have four children and two (amazing) grandchildren.
